Q.

A ball is dropped from a bridge 122.5 m above a river. After the ball has been falling for 2s, a second
ball is thrown straight down after it. What must be the initial velocity of the second ball, so that both
ball hit the water at the same time?

Detailed Solution

detailed_solution_thumbnail

Let the ball hit water in t second.

For first ball,         s=ut+12at2

                   122.5=0+12×9.8×t2=4.9t2 

                        t=122.54.9=25=5 s

For second ball,  122.5=u(5-2)+12×9.8×(5-2)2

                                     = 3u + 44.1
                           3u = 122.5 ~ 44.1
                                3u = 78.4  u = 26.1 ms-1
